Finally got a few days of the right kind of weather for enjoying outdoor Idaho detecting. These pictures are of an area along the Coeur d' Alene River that has been popular with fishermen and campers for many years. It's B.L.M. land (public). and I've hunted the actual campsites several times in the past but have experienced the hot spots are usually where the vehicles park. Thought I'd try a little different approach this time and worked up and down the actual road from my parking spot. Was pleasantly surprised to dig over 60 coins in the area shown in the pictures. 2- Wheats 58d and 41s others from mostly 60's and 70's. Nothing awesome but easy diggin' and maybe you know of a road in your area. Enjoy your summer you all.
